Sanskriti International School has been in existence for over a decade. Sanskriti is located at Halchowk, just off the ring-road but with a quiet and peaceful environment. From the academic year commencing 2078, we will take our first batch of students in grade XI. We aim to provide quality education to those pursuing the plus two program with us to enable them to pursue higher education in the field of business, management, science and technology.

As per the demands required by the present day market environment we intend to inculcate in our students, qualities of leadership in an innovative teaching learning environment. We will focus on the need to enhance their abilities of critical thinking and methods of problem solving.

The National Examinations Board’s two year higher secondary program is rigorous and meets academic standards required by the most prestigious universities around the world for their undergraduate courses.

Eligibility Criteria

Students are eligible to apply for the plus two program after completing SEE

  1. Science
  • GPA 3
  • C+ in Math and Science
  • D+ in other Subjects
  1. Management and Humanities
  • GPA 2.7
  • D+ in all Subjects
